Chinese special aluminum alloy manufacturer develops ultra-high-strength aluminum alloy

SXCQ Metal Material Technology Co., Ltd. has developed an ultra-high-strength aluminum alloy that exceeds all existing international indicators-7Y69, and has obtained 37 invention patents in this field. It is understood that this result has cost more than 70 million yuan after ten years of hard research and development.

Leading international wear-resistant full density high strength

The ultra-high-strength aluminum alloy invented this time adopts brand-new invention technology, and the product has the characteristics of wear-resistant rigidity and high strength, which is at the international leading level. Ultra-high-strength aluminum alloy 7Y69 adopts new technology to produce high-performance ultra-abrasive and ultra-high-strength products. Its relative density can reach more than 99.6%. After subsequent hot processing (forging, rolling, extrusion or hot pressing), it can also be formed. Full dense product.

After 7Y69 is processed by T6 technology, its thermal conductivity is approximately 171W / mK; linear expansion coefficient is approximately 23.5um / (mK); elongation A% 3.5, hardness HRB≥98, compressive strength greater than 80 MPa, the indicators are all International leader.

The National Patent Office's summary of the 7Y69 patent description said: "The present invention provides an ultra-high-strength aluminum alloy and a preparation method thereof. The aluminum alloy material is prepared with a specific formula. Its microstructure is significantly refined and precipitated. The phase is small and uniformly distributed, making its mechanical properties almost anisotropic, and has the advantages of high strength, high toughness, high rigidity, and light weight. Experimental results show that after the T6 treatment of the ultra-high strength aluminum alloy provided by the present invention, its Tensile strength ≥917MPa, yield strength ≥874MPa ".

Compared with the traditional process, this technology ensures the uniform and fine distribution of the alloy without segregation. It has the characteristics of high accuracy, uniform structure, excellent performance, and low comprehensive production cost. It also has high corrosion resistance, and is resistant to high salt and acid. High alkali has good anti-corrosion effect, especially the unique anti-corrosion property to seawater. The product is still bright as new after three years of experimental immersion in various sea areas of our country, there is no parasite phenomenon of marine life, and it has no pollution to the environment. Widely used in the traditional metal manufacturing industry

The significance of this invention, such as ultra-high-strength aluminum alloys, lies not only in the optimization of aluminum alloy properties and the international leadership of various indicators, but also in its broad application scope and manufacturing prospects.

Relevant experts believe that the invention and application of ultra-high-strength aluminum alloys have completely solved the material problems for the production of petroleum and natural gas pipelines and ultra-high pressure vessels, which has made China leap into the world's leading position in the field of ultra-high pressure vessel manufacturing.

Products made of ultra-high-strength aluminum alloy can be widely used in aerospace and navigation, weapon industry, oil pipeline transportation, urban water pipeline network, electronic information engineering, modern construction, transportation bridges, medical equipment, auto parts, engineering machinery and other high-precision Pointed field. In particular, the melting point of this product is only 780 degrees Celsius, which is very suitable for 3D printing materials.
